Induction program
In accordance with UniSA policy, all new staff must complete an induction
program with both The Wark and UniSA. All new staff are required to
complete The Wark on-line induction and the UniSA induction website orientation.
There are also a number of on-line OHSW&IM training modules which must be
completed. A list of which modules you must complete will be forwarded
to you by the HR Officer upon commencement.

Leave of absence
All staff must submit an on-line application for either recreation or
personal (sick) leave and all other types of leave (special leave, family
responsibility and long service leave), via the
myHR system (link via myUniSA site on UniSA Homepage). ALL applications
must be sent to Madelene Pierce in the first instance (not your line
manager/supervisor).
For professional staff utilising flexitime, a leave form must be completed. Once this form has been signed by your immediate supervisor, please forward it to Madelene Pierce.
Performance management
This is conducted as per the University's
performance management
scheme, with the minimum of an annual performance
review meeting with your line supervisor. Prior to this meeting, each staff
member must complete a Performance Review and Development Plan which
provides the foundation for discussions. Templates are available for Wark
research
academic staff and professional staff.
